Rational and Irrational Crimes - Rational crimes are those committed with intent; offender is in full possession of his mental faculties /capabilities while Irrational crimes are committed without intent; offender does not know the nature of his act. Irrational criminals are motivated by their emotions, such as anger, fear, and hatred. Rational thinking is driven by experience and facts. One of the most heavily researched variables of rational choice in criminology is the probability of apprehension (p) and how it relates to crime prevention. Many studies have found evidence of a negative relationship between employment rates and wages with crime; this might lead criminologists to support the inclusion of net benefit when testing RCT, which consists of total gain minus the opportunity cost of time spent in criminal activity.
